What's The Definition Of Dukkha?

dukkha in American English
noun: the first of the Four Noble Truths, that all human experience is transient and that suffering results from excessive desire and attachment

dukkha in British English
noun: (in Theravada Buddhism) the belief that all things are suffering, due to the desire to seek permanence or recognize the self when neither exist: one of the three basic characteristics of existence
